Dong-Uk Seo is a robotics researcher whose work centers on visual simultaneous localization and mapping (SLAM) and depth completion—critical technologies for autonomous navigation and 3D scene understanding. His most notable contribution, "Struct-MDC: Mesh-Refined Unsupervised Depth Completion Leveraging Structural Regularities From Visual SLAM" (2022), addresses a fundamental limitation of feature-based visual SLAM: the sparsity of depth estimates. By introducing a mesh-refined, unsupervised depth completion method that exploits structural regularities from SLAM, Seo enables the generation of dense depth maps from sparse feature data—a breakthrough that bridges the gap between efficient feature tracking and the dense perception required for robust robotic operation. This work has already garnered 15 citations, reflecting its significance in the field. Seo’s research is particularly impactful for applications in autonomous driving, drone navigation, and mobile robotics, where accurate depth perception is essential. His innovative approach to combining SLAM with depth completion demonstrates a deep understanding of both geometric constraints and learning-based methods, positioning him as a rising contributor to the advancement of intelligent perception systems.
